Tender description

This Tender is for the procurement of a document handling and workflow solution, to provide a holistic solution for the processing of incoming and outgoing documents. This should include functionality to; capture data from incoming emails and attached documents; format and distribute outgoing documents such as invoices and statements; automate related processes via workflow capabilities; store and retrieve processed documents; and interface with the System21 ERP and/or DB2 databases either via xml, API or other methods. The contract has the option to extend for up to a further 36 months. The total value stated includes the option period.
